2. Microsoft Tag. I observed Tag using a twist of fate when I figured I’d look for Microsoft-evolved iPhone applications. The Tag is notable. You can print up free barcodes and stick them on brochures, magazine articles, enterprise cards, or even actual property signs and symptoms, and those can experiment with them with their mobile phones. Once a Tag is scanned, the character is taken to a cellular site containing greater product statistics. Because the Tag routs via Microsoft’s server, marketers have to get the right of entry to analytics approximately which Tags are popular, permitting them to shape advertising approaches for this reason. Oh, and did I mention that Tag is unfastened? I recognize I did, but it is worth announcing a few instances. The Tag is much like QR codes, but they are customizable – you could affect their design, allowing them to fit your logo better.

4. Fluther. At first glance, Fluther looks as if a fancied-up query and answer board. However, it is a signal toward an extra shrewd net. When Google bought Aardvark, they did so because it was indexing a massive quantity of social statistics. Fluther gets people to ask the net a specific question, and other people (now not machines) reply, after which the asker opts for which solution becomes the most informative. Because this data is saved online, it holds a giant fee to humans who are inquisitive about developing the subsequent technology search era. Fluther also makes it easy to enter and contribute to these statistics from your website. They got offered out using Twitter recently… It seems a person is paying attention to it. Are you?

Eight. Google Sets. Google Sets is a thrilling tool for net entrepreneurs and people interested in online statistics control. Sets offer you relationships between phrases, which is useful while determining what keywords you must choose in AdWords. Sets allow you to run queries about semantics, and that means (as Google sees it) which can be thrilling but is most effective and groundbreaking when applied to different projects. I, in my opinion, hope that Google keeps Sets around as a subset of services like Trends. I find it to be a beneficial keyword research tool for search engine marketing.

10. Yahoo Pipes. I have not used Pipes yet, but I’m running on it. Pipes is a beneficial application that permits you to pull information from all over the net and flow it to 1 web page. You will have RSS feeds, Tweets, and more mashed collectively to provide site visitors with a complete view of conversations about a selected topic. Pipes is one of those matters.
